Git使用

1.撤销本地和远程修改(万不得已这样做)
先拷贝出自己本地的修改的文件
git checkout . 撤销本地修改
git reset --hard id 撤销远程修改
然后删除远程自己的分支,直接git push就会在远程生成对应的自己的远程分支

2.更新代码
git pull --rebase origin develop

git pull = git fetch + git merge
git pull --rebase = git fetch + git rebase
遇到冲突,一个一个解决
解决好了某一个 git rebase --continue
任何时候git rebase --abort,分支会回到rebase开始前的状态

https://blog.csdn.net/u011163372/article/details/73995897
https://www.cnblogs.com/kevingrace/p/5896706.html
https://www.cnblogs.com/wangiqngpei557/p/6056624.html

git1.PNG
git2.PNG
git3.PNG
git4.PNG

参考:http://www.cnblogs.com/qdhxhz/p/9757390.html
http://www.runoob.com/git/git-workspace-index-repo.html

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• (预警:因为详细,所以行文有些长,新手边看边操作效果出乎你的预料) 一:Git是什么? Git是目前世界上最先进的...
    axiaochao阅读 1,965评论 1 8
  • git 使用笔记 git原理: 文件(blob)对象,树(tree)对象,提交(commit)对象 tree对象 ...
    神刀阅读 3,805评论 0 10
  • Git使用教程:https://blog.csdn.net/tgbus18990140382/article/de...
    SkTj阅读 2,830评论 1 11
  • (预警:因为详细,所以行文有些长,新手边看边操作效果出乎你的预料)一:Git是什么?Git是目前世界上最先进的分布...
    嘤嘤嘤999阅读 1,582评论 2 48
  • 昨天在同事电脑上操作了一把cherry-pick代码,发现很多功能不用,就慢慢忘记了,梳理了下流程图: git c...
    gogoingmonkey阅读 700评论 0 0